Suggest Treatment For Explosive Diarrhea Along With Fecal Incontinence

Question: Yes...
Over the past year I have had three boughts of diarrhea with no warning. No cramps or even the feeling that I have to go to the bathroom. When it hit it’s almost explosive. When it happens I have absolutely no control over it. No matter how hard I try to tighten up to stop it at least till I can get to a bathroom I have no effect.

Fecal incontinence is the inability to control bowel movements, causing stool to leak unexpectedly from the rectum. It ranges from an occasional leakage of stool while passing gas to a complete loss of bowel control.As in your case very likely its occassional.Common causes of fecal incontinence include diarrhea, constipation, and muscle or nerve damage. The muscle or nerve damage is more common in old age.
Tests suggested-
Stool test to see the cause of recurrent diarrhea.
Digital rectal exam- Insertion of lubricated finger into your rectum to evaluate the strength of your sphincter muscles and to check for any abnormalities in the rectal area.
Magnetic resonance imaging which can provide clear pictures of the sphincter to determine if the muscles are intact.
Treatment would depend on the results of these tests.
